“Gospel music is alive and well in the Seventh-day Adventist Church,” exclaims National Gospel Announcers Guild chair Al “The Bishop” Hobbs.

He has a point. SDA is not a denomination well-known for gospel music, but the 300-voice Spring Into Praise Mass Choir is helping to change that.

“I Command My Soul” is the single from the group’s self-produced album, Under His Wings, recorded live at Morehouse College in Atlanta. The praise outing is a Lamar Campbell composition that Campbell himself leads with appropriate verve. The choir matches Campbell in vocal heft and is every bit as bouncy and energetic as any mass choir. It’s as if the group is summoning its collective force to blow down the walls of tradition.

The Spring Into Praise Mass Choir was organized by Bruce N. Seawood, minister of music at Atlanta Berean SDA Church, where Dr. Carlton P. Byrd is senior pastor.
